A local government authority in the United Kingdom is seeking a Senior Educational Psychologist to supervise and manage educational psychologists while supporting service delivery and strategic initiatives.

The role offers flexible hybrid working, a salary between £61,721 and £66,156, and various benefits including a substantial relocation package and professional development opportunities.

The candidate should hold relevant qualifications and a valid driving licence.
